Job DescriptionAbout the role
- Region - Czech Republic & Slovakia
- As a Field Clinical Specialist in the Advanced Patient Monitoring division, you will be responsible for providing clinical expertise and support for our highly innovative technologies in Hemodynamic Monitoring in hospitals. Your role will involve educating and training healthcare professionals on the use of medical devices, including during surgical procedures and in the ICU, ensuring safe and effective adoption. Additionally, you will play a crucial role in achieving sales targets by collaborating closely with the sales team and driving product adoption.
- Provide education and training to physicians, hospital personnel, and staff on the technical aspects of our medical devices, including device handling, in-servicing, and troubleshooting techniques.
- Support product evaluations by providing expertise on device usage, procedure, and protocol throughout the entire project timeline.
- Collaborate with sales teams to implement growth and expansion strategies within focused accounts and achieve sales targets.
- Monitor clinical support activities, market changes, and competitive activity.
- Develop and continuously improve training curriculum, materials, and tools based on clinical experience and company guidelines.
- Maintain advanced clinical knowledge of our medical devices and technologies.
- Bachelor's degree in a related field.
- Previous experience as an anesthesia or intensive care nurse, or a biomedical engineer is highly preferred.
- Previous experience in medical device and/or clinical support roles is an advantage.
- Strong written and verbal communication skills.
- Ability to travel up to 60% of the time.
- Proven expertise in MS Office Suite and general office machinery.
- Fluency in Czech and high proficiency in English are mandatory.
